1955 Brown II. Supreme Court rules that school desegregation must take place with "all deliberate speed."
-
Supreme Court orders Prince Edward County schools reopened.
-
Civil Rights Act passed.
-
Cecile Epps petitions School Board with 83 signatures in request to start integration process in Nelson County.
-
March- Project Opportunity, a talent development program sponsored by Ford & Danforth Corporations became first integrated educational experience for Nelson County 7th & 8th graders
-
School Board adopts Freedom of Choice Plan to desegregate 1, 2, 7, 8, & 12th grades
-
School Board closes Nelson Memorial and fully integrates Nelson County High School. Nelson Memorial transitions into an integrated junior high school.
-
Green v. New Kent County School Board: Supreme Court established “Green Factors” ruled Freedom of Choice as an unacceptable integration plan.
-
Sept. 29- All Nelson County schools are fully integrated
-
Alexander v. Holmes Board of Education: Supreme Court eliminates all segregated dual education systems.
